What Is the McDonald's Dinner Box
The McDonald's dinner box is a bundled meal format offered at participating U.S. locations, typically combining a main, side, and drink at a set price. The box targets families and groups looking for a lower-cost shared meal compared to ordering items individually. Dinner Box Contents and Pricing
Typical Items Included
A standard McDonald's dinner box often includes a choice of burger or chicken sandwich, fries, a drink, and sometimes a dessert or additional side. Specific items may feature the McChicken, McDouble, or chicken McNuggets depending on the region and current menu rollout. The box is designed to serve two to four people, with calorie counts and allergen information available on the company's nutrition calculator and in-store materials McDonald's nutrition info.
Price Range and Value Positioning
As of the latest public menu data, the McDonald's dinner box is typically priced between roughly $5 and $8, though local taxes and franchise pricing can shift the final cost. The box competes with other value bundles from fast-food chains such as Wendy's, Burger King, and Taco Bell, which also offer family-style meal packs at similar price points fast-food value meals comparison.
Availability and Ordering Options
Where to Find the Dinner Box
The McDonald's dinner box is available at many U.S. McDonald's locations, but not all franchisees offer the same bundle format. Availability depends on local menu boards, kitchen setup, and the operator's decision to feature the box as a permanent or promotional item. Customers can check the McDonald's app, website, or in-store menu boards to confirm whether the dinner box is listed at their nearest restaurant McDonald's restaurant finder.
Ordering Through Digital Channels
McDonald's allows customers to order the dinner box through the McDonald's app, Drive-Thru, and delivery platforms such as Uber Eats and DoorDash where available. Digital ordering systems often display the box as a preset bundle, with customization options limited to drink size and side swaps depending on the location McDonald's digital ordering trends.
